Background

Kim Michelle Toft is a full time marine artist, author, illustrator and publisher of environmental children's books depicting vibrant underwater worlds handpainted on silk.

5 years teaching in Far North Queensland.
5 years graphic designer in Adelaide, South Australia.
20 years full time silk artist/illustrator and author in Northern NSW.
19 solo exhibitions at the Sheraton Mirage Port Douglas, Gold Coast, Bisbane and Noosa with sales exceeding over 1,200 paintings, including sales to Morris West, Jerry Hall and Mick Jagger.

Featured artist at the Maui Marine Art Expo, Hawaii 1996.
First four children's books - One Less Fish, Neptune's Nursery, Turtle's Song and The World That We Want - selling more than 100,000 copies in Australia, USA, New Zealand, South Africa, and South Korea. All four books have received international and national awards. Publisher: QU
A Sea of Words with companion Alphabet Wall Frieze - released in May 2006, awarded Notable Book in the CBCA Awards 2007. Publisher: Silkim Books.

My latest book, The 12 Underwater Days of Christmas, released September 2007. Publisher SIlkim Books. A CD is currently in production to go with this popular Christmas classic. Release date October 2008.
